运维管理系统作为IT运维的核心工具,承担着监控、管理、优化和维护IT基础设施的重任
而服务器配置作为运维管理系统的基石,其重要性不言而喻
本文将深入探讨运维管理系统服务器配置的关键要素、最佳实践以及如何通过优化配置来提升运维效率和系统稳定性
一、运维管理系统服务器配置的重要性 运维管理系统通过集中化管理、自动化监控和智能分析等功能,极大地提升了IT运维的效率和准确性
然而,这一切功能的实现都离不开底层服务器配置的支撑
服务器配置决定了系统的处理能力、响应速度、安全性和可扩展性,直接影响运维管理的效果和用户体验
1.处理能力:服务器配置决定了系统能够处理的任务数量和复杂度
合理的配置可以确保系统在高负载下依然能够稳定运行,避免业务中断
2.响应速度:服务器性能直接影响运维管理系统对用户请求的响应速度
优化配置可以缩短响应时间,提升用户体验
3.安全性:服务器配置是保障系统安全的第一道防线
通过合理配置防火墙、入侵检测系统等安全措施,可以有效防范外部攻击和内部泄露
4.可扩展性:随着业务的发展,运维管理系统需要不断扩展以满足新的需求
良好的服务器配置可以确保系统在扩展过程中保持稳定性和高效性
二、运维管理系统服务器配置的关键要素 运维管理系统服务器配置涉及多个方面,包括硬件选择、操作系统配置、数据库配置、网络配置等
以下是对这些关键要素的详细分析
1.硬件选择 -CPU:选择高性能的CPU可以确保系统处理能力的提升
对于运算密集型任务,如数据分析、日志处理等,多核处理器是更好的选择
-内存:足够的内存可以确保系统在高负载下依然能够稳定运行
对于需要频繁读写内存的任务,如实时监控、报警处理等,应优先考虑大容量内存
-存储:存储设备的性能和容量直接影响系统的读写速度和数据存储能力
SSD(固态硬盘)具有更高的读写速度和更好的耐用性,是运维管理系统服务器的理想选择
-网络:高速、稳定的网络接口可以确保系统与外部网络的顺畅通信
对于需要传输大量数据的任务,如日志备份、远程监控等,应优先考虑千兆网络接口
2.操作系统配置 -版本选择:选择稳定、安全的操作系统版本是确保系统稳定运行的基础
对于运维管理系统来说,Linux是一个常用的选择,因其具有良好的稳定性和可扩展性
-内核参数优化:通过调整操作系统内核参数,可以优化系统性能
例如,调整TCP连接参数可以提高网络传输效率;调整内存管理参数可以提高系统响应速度
-安全配置:加强操作系统的安全配置是防范外部攻击的关键
应定期更新系统补丁、配置防火墙和入侵检测系统,并限制不必要的服务端口和权限
3.数据库配置 -数据库选择:根据运维管理系统的需求选择合适的数据库类型
对于需要频繁读写、实时性要求高的任务,如实时监控、报警处理等,可以选择MySQL、PostgreSQL等关系型数据库;对于需要处理大量非结构化数据的任务,如日志分析、数据挖掘等,可以选择MongoDB、Cassandra等NoSQL数据库
-性能优化:通过调整数据库参数、优化索引、分区等手段,可以提高数据库的性能
例如,调整缓存大小、连接池大小等参数可以提高数据库的读写速度;优化索引可以加快查询速度;分区可以提高数据库的扩展性和可维护性
-数据备份与恢复:定期备份数据库数据是确保数据安全的重要手段
应配置自动备份策略,并测试备份数据的恢复能力
4.网络配置 -网络拓扑设计:合理的网络拓扑设计可以提高网络的可靠性和性能
对于运维管理系统来说,可以采用冗余网络设计,如双网卡绑定、多路径路由等,以提高网络的可靠性和容错性
-带宽管理:根据业务需求合理分配网络带宽资源
对于需要传输大量数据的任务,如日志备份、远程监控等,应优先考虑高带宽网络接口和链路
-网络安全:加强网络安全配置是防范外部攻击的关键
应配置防火墙、入侵检测系统、VPN等安全措施,并限制不必要的网络访问和端口
三、运维管理系统服务器配置的最佳实践 1.性能监控与调优 - 定期监控服务器性能,包括CPU使用率、内存占用率、磁盘I/O等关键指标
根据监控结果及时调整配置,以优化系统性能
- 对于性能瓶颈问题,应进行详细分析并找出根本原因
通过优化代码、调整数据库参数、升级硬件等手段,解决性能瓶颈问题
2.自动化部署与配置管理 - 采用自动化部署工具(如Ansible、Puppet等)实现服务器的自动化部署和配置管理
通过自动化部署可以减少人为错误,提高部署效率和准确性
- 建立配置管理数据库(CMDB),记录服务器的配置信息、依赖关系等关键数据
通过CMDB可以方便地查询和管理服务器配置,提高运维效率
3.高可用性与容灾备份 - 配置高可用性集群(如Keepalived、HAProxy等),实现服务器的负载均衡和故障切换
通过高可用性集群可以提高系统的可靠性和容错性
- 建立容灾备份机制,包括数据备份、系统备份和灾难恢复计划等
通过容灾备份机制可以确保在系统故障或灾难发生时能够快速恢复业务
4.安全加固与合规性检查 - 定期对服务器进行安全加固,包括更新系统补丁、配置防火墙和入侵检测系统、限制不必要的服务端口和权限等
通过安全加固可以提高系统的安全性
- 定期进行合规性检查,确保服务器配置符合